Cloud Control are an alternative rock band originating from the Blue Mountains near Sydney, Australia. The band is currently signed to the Australian label Ivy League Records, in which they released their debut album Bliss Release, to Infectious Music in the UK/Europe and to Turnout Records in North America. The band has supported a host of local and international acts, including Arcade Fire, Vampire Weekend, Supergrass, The Magic Numbers, Yves Klein Blue, The Temper Trap, Last Dinosaurs and Local Natives.
They have been nominated for a clutch of awards in Australia, including 2 ARIA awards. Most recently, the band was nominated for the Australian Music Prize, which they subsequently won on 3 March 2011.
All growing up in the Blue Mountains, the four met at the rehearsals for Pirates of the Penzance, where a series of random events led them to the green room. There they started talking to each other and it was from there that they decided to enter their first "Battle of the Bands". The band subsequently won, and continued on to record and release their debut self-titled EP in 2008. The single from Cloud Control, "Death Cloud," was picked up by Australian youth radio station Triple J and received strong airplay. The band were also selected to open for Supergrass on their tour of Australia.
